Abstract
Background: Cancer is a disease caused by manifestation and abnormal gene expression. Many of the genes that inhibit cancer by the microRNAs. The aim of this study was to investigate the Expression of miR155 gene and CEA and VEGF proteins as Diagnostic Markers in Early Stages of Non-Small Cell Lung Cancer (NSCLC).
Materials and Methods: Fifty pairs of non-small lung cancer specimens of patients from healthy and tumors specimens were collected based on physical examination and diagnosis of an expert, that, in Masih Daneshvari Hospital. 50 healthy volunteers as a control group were volunteered by the physician after examination and filled out the consent form in this study. From all subjects, 6 ml of peripheral blood were taken and examined by Real-Time PCR (RT-PCR) and ELISA.
Results: The expression level of miR-155 in patients was significantly increased compared to the control group (p<0.001). VEGF protein was positive in 34 of the 50 patients and in healthy subjects, 3 persons were positive. The statistical comparison of the amount of positive biomarker was performed in two groups and it was shown that there is a statistically significant difference between these two groups (P<0.001). CEA protein was positive in 38 of the 50 patients and 5 in healthy subjects were positive. The statistical comparison of the amount of positive biomarker was performed in two groups and it was shown that there is a statistically significant difference between these two groups (P<0.001).
Conclusion: This study showed that miR155 gene and CEA and VEGF proteins are relatively good markers for the diagnosis of non-small cell lung cancer patients in Iranian population.
